Canada, CEF. A 220th Infantry Battalion "York Rangers" Cap Badge Archive the story of the menIn pickled brass, unmarked, measuring 47. 3 mm (w) x 46. 7 mm (h), both lugs intact, extremely fine. Footnote: The Battalion was raised in Toronto, Ontario with mobilization headquarters at Toronto under the authority of G. O. 69, July 15, 1916. The Battalion sailed April 29, 1917 under the command of Lieutenant Colonel B. H. Brown with a strength of 18 officers and 446 other ranks. In England, the Battalion was absorbed into the 3rd Reserve
